Pranav Sidharthan
Being a big fan of Grand Malabar in Waterloo, we were excited to try the new Grand Malabar Express in Cambridge—and it did not disappoint!

We ordered the Fish Curry Meal and Chicken Mandi. The mandi is available only in half ($26) and full portions. The taste was excellent, with flavorful rice reminiscent of authentic Kerala-style biryani. It came with delicious mayonnaise and tangy tomato chutney. The chicken was well-cooked, and the mandi overall was exceptional.

The Fish Curry Meal was equally impressive, with a rich, flavorful curry and perfectly cooked fish. The pricing is reasonable, making it a great spot for Kerala food lovers in the Kitchener-Waterloo-Cambridge (KWC) region.

A big appreciation for the consistency in taste and quality that Grand Malabar maintains. The staff were friendly and welcoming, and the restaurant has ample parking. The ambiance is clean and inviting.

Highly recommended!
